International Financial Reporting Standards (IFRS) shall be applied by Indian Companies from F.Y. 2015-16 voluntarily and from F.Y. 2016-17 on a mandatory basis

The Finance Minister in the Budget speech 2014-15 announced that the Indian Accounting Standards (Ind AS) i.e. accounting standards based largely on with International Financial Reporting Standards (IFRS) shall be applied by Indian Companies from F.Y. 2015-16 voluntarily and from F.Y. 2016-17 on a mandatory basis. CBDT has signed a bilateral Advance Pricing Agreement (APA) with a Japanese Company

Government of India  Department of Revenue  PRESS RELEASE     On 19.12.2014, Central Board of Direct Taxes has signed a bilateral Advance Pricing Agreement (APA) with a Japanese Company.
